Illustration
Raised in Michigan where entire choirs of summertime frogs sing in bogs beside country roads, I missed the voice of even one frog in the relatively dry land of western Nebraska. After living 14 years in the panhandle, I no longer instinctively listened for this sign of summer.
The 15th spring, however, brought an inordinately heavy rainfall. Usually, earth drank in any moisture that fell. However that summer, the soil had its fill. Ponds stood in wheat fields. Ducks appeared from somewhere to crowd country ditches.
